What to Expect on the Day of the Tour

Day of the Tour

So, typically the rendezvous spots are conveniently right in Page, it means you are just able to hop over easily from pretty much any hotel in the vicinity, right? Usually there’s a quick bit of paperwork, you may find there are waivers just confirming, more or less, that you get the general risk situation for going on trails, etc. Then the guides often provide context – background bits, about the canyon itself, Navajo Nation stories, the way geology created all these twisting walls. Right, it all makes what you’re about to look at way richer, honestly. What follows after is normally this short drive in that hardy 4×4 over to the canyon mouth itself.

Anyway, it’s pretty essential to sort of follow the guide’s advice to the letter; it’s all to do with looking after the slot canyon’s well-being and, keeping everyone in your tour safely tucked away from hazards. They also have the best angles sussed to help you get photos to make you feel like a professional. Take your time just strolling and exploring, which helps to bathe everything slowly, honestly. Seriously let this vibe work into you as the trip unwinds. Then the tour sort of ambles gently on out, finally winding its way back towards Page again. Most of the top companies have thought about leaving memories by providing photo services either while you go around, at no cost and on a sharing basis or for purchase later.

Navigating the Canyon: What to Wear and Bring

Navigating the Canyon

Okay, let’s talk clothing – layers are really essential. Arizona can switch fast, especially at canyon depth. In winter or when raining, take a light waterproof covering along; basically, you never know. Any pair of sturdy trainers will cope; hiking boots almost seem too much, really. And frankly, bring eyewear for the sun, slather some sunblock, just put that hat on. But you know what’s not going to happen? Getting mobile coverage most times; go enjoy going unconnected to tech. Finally – just water and perhaps some nuts/granola bits, to fuel those jaunts. This slot requires you carry just a few essentials very simply, which allows you keep relaxed as the tour winds on.
